SCHOMAKER, Joseph J. Age 78 of Colerain Township, Ohio passed away at Good Samaritan Hospital in Cincinnati on Friday, December 22, 2006. He was born on March 14, 1928 in Cincinnati, Ohio the son of Joseph and Dorothy (Graf) Schomaker. He married Dorothy Burwinkel and together they farmed in the Ross area for many years. He is survived by his wife of 55 years, Dorothy Schomaker of Colerain Township; two sons, Joseph and Thomas (Melissa) Schomaker; five grandchildren, Dr. Deanna Caminiti, Joseph Schomaker IV, and Kara, Ryan, and T.J. Schomaker; three great grandchildren Ethan Schomaker and Dean and Alex Caminiti; three sisters Cleta Hermann, Betty Rieman, and Elva Brunner; and many other loving relatives and friends. He was preceded in death by one son, Jerry Schomaker.
